抄録

In phase 1 of the Japan's Methane Hydrate Exploitation Program, the method to decrease the hydro static pressure by use of a submersible pump (the depressurization method) was recognized to be essential for the production technique. In phase 2, the basic design for the down hole production test system for offshore production tests was implemented by combining the technologies for DST (drill stem test) that are usually used in conventional oil and gas offshore production test operations. In respect of the surface production test system, the basic plan related to the necessary production facilities was designed and the specification of the floating drilling vessel suitable for the necessary facilities was also investigated. Regarding the produced water treatment system, framing of the conceptual design, organizing the regulations related to discharge, and examination of the environmental assessment have been investigated.
